 About CapFrameX 

This is a 3rd party tool for frametimes capture and analysis based on Intel's PresentMon. The overlay is provided by Rivatuner Statistics Server (RTSS). 

  

CapFrameX Installation instructions: 

  1. Go to https://www.capframex.com/download and download the latest version of CapframeX. 
  2. Go to https://www.guru3d.com/files-details/rtss-rivatuner-statistics-server-download.html and download the latest version of RTSS. 
  3. Unzip both installers and install them. 
  4. Launch CapFrameX and then close it. This is so it creates the user Configuration folder. 
  5. Download and unzip the file OverlayEntryConfiguration_0.json (attached in this post) with the recommended RTSS configuration. 
  6. Paste this file to %userprofile%\Documents\CapFrameX\Configuration
  7. In the Capture tab, set the "Capture time" to 0. This is to remove the preset limit in capture time. 
  8. In the Overlay tab, uncheck "Auto-Disable OSD" and click the save icon. 

  

Capturing the Performance Data: 

  1. Open CapframeX and do NOT minimize or close it. 
  2. Open the game and go to the part of the game you need to be to reproduce the issue. You should see the RTSS overlay in the top left corner of your screen, with the status "<game name> ready to capture…". 
  3. Press F11 to start capturing data and reproduce the issue. The Status in the overlay will change to "Recording frametimes XX s". 
  4. Once you have reproduced the issue, press F11 to finish the data capturing. The Status in the overlay will change to "Processing data". 
  5. Back to CapFrameX, you can find all the data captures in the left panel of the Analysis tab. Clicking any one of these captures will display the results on the right. 
  6. To export the data captured as a JSON file, right click the capture and click on "Copy/paste recording file(s)".

I managed to solve the problem. Actually, there was a game configuration folder in the Windows documents, and apparently there was a remnant of the RTX graphics settings there. After deleting the folder and running the game again, the FPS is now between 60 and 80 on ultra settings. Thank you for your attention and support!
